------------------ From: Felix Fietkau <n...@openwrt.org> commit 3adcf20afb585993ffee24de36d1975f6b26b120 upstream. During teardown, mac80211 will not return a new beacon. This is normal and handled properly in the driver, so there's no need to spam the user with a kernel warning here. Signed-off-by: Felix Fietkau <n...@openwrt.org> Signed-off-by: John W.
